Kingfishers (Alcedinidae)

HBW 6, p. 130

  • Small to medium-sized, compact birds with long, straight and dagger-like bill, short legs and often with bright plumage colours.
  • Cosmopolitan.
  • Mostly forest or woodland, often by water, some in open woodland away from water, one in desert scrub.
  • 17 genera, 92 species, 315 taxa.
  • 10 species threatened; 2 subspecies extinct since 1600.
